Django赋能:极速构建安全高效Web应用
|
作为一名前端安全工程师,我深知在现代Web开发中,安全性与性能往往是一对难以平衡的矛盾。而Django,作为一款全功能的Python Web框架,正以其强大的内置安全机制和高效的架构设计,成为构建安全高效Web应用的理想选择。 Django从设计之初就将安全放在了核心位置。它提供了诸如CSRF保护、XSS过滤、SQL注入防护等开箱即用的安全功能,这些机制能够有效防止常见的Web攻击手段。对于前端安全工程师而言,这意味着我们可以更专注于业务逻辑的实现,而不必过度担忧底层安全细节。 同时,Django的ORM(对象关系映射)系统不仅简化了数据库操作,还通过参数化查询有效避免了SQL注入的风险。这种设计让开发者能够以更简洁的方式编写代码,同时也提升了系统的可维护性和扩展性。 在性能方面,Django同样表现出色。它支持缓存机制、异步任务处理以及高效的模板引擎,这些特性使得应用在高并发场景下依然能够保持稳定运行。结合合理的前端优化策略,如资源压缩、懒加载和CDN加速,可以进一步提升用户体验。
分析图由AI辅助,仅供参考 Django的社区生态丰富,有大量的第三方库和工具可供选择。无论是身份验证、权限管理还是日志记录,都能找到成熟可靠的解决方案。这为前端安全工程师提供了更多灵活性,能够根据项目需求快速搭建起安全的后端服务。站长看法,Django不仅仅是一个Web框架,它更像是一个完整的开发平台。通过合理利用其内置的安全机制和高性能特性,我们能够更快地构建出既安全又高效的Web应用,从而更好地服务于用户和业务需求。 (编辑:开发网_商丘站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330475号